Thomas, a man known for his sharp suits and even sharper deals, unearthed a letter while sorting through his late father's belongings. The letter, addressed to his father but never sent, was a plea for financial assistance, a stark reminder of a time when Thomas's own needs had seemed paramount. He noticed his hands were trembling as he read.

The words echoed with a raw, almost desperate urgency. "I need…" the letter began, outlining expenses, aspirations. He re-read the sentence. The old words echoed in his mind, and the old desires were reborn. A familiar tightening in his gut, the familiar thrill. He thought about the expensive watch on his wrist, the luxury car parked outside. He thought about the wealth he'd amassed, the resources at his disposal.

He remembered the sting of his father's refusal to send money. Now, in the letter, it seemed like he was once again being rejected. He felt a phantom pang of outrage. He imagined the words, the pleas as his own now, an entitlement that had never been satisfied. The letter felt like a debt owed. His teeth ground together. He wanted more. More than he ever thought to have.

Role in Research

This story is one of 1,000 stories generated for the emotion greedy. During extraction, it was fed through Gemma4-31B and its hidden state activations were captured at 11 layers.

The mean activation across all 1,000 greedy stories, after denoising with neutral dialogue baselines, produces the greedy emotion vector -- a direction in the model's 5,376-dimensional representation space.
